Update - Costs of Pedestrian Signals at Les Rouvets and Rectory Hill

Share this page

Friday 14 February 2014

Environment Department response to media enquiry from Guernsey Press.

Guernsey Press Enquiry: 

How much has this project cost the department and how much will the Rectory Hill work cost?

Environment Department Response:

The works at Les Rouvets cost approximately £36,000.

The Environment Department is currently awaiting a quotation for the works at Rectory Hill junction from its signal contractor, Siemens, but it is estimated that the works will cost in the region of £25,000.
